About the GR 128 Variant Sint-Truiden trail
At 10.4 miles with 155 feet of elevation gain, GR 128 Variant Sint-Truiden runs out and back through Belgium, from 98 feet at its lowest to 293 feet at its highest. The steepest pitch reaches 5 percent, against an average of 15 feet of gain per mile. On our gain-and-distance scale it falls in the moderate band. The nearest town is Heers, 3 miles away.
The trail
The GR 128 is a long-distance hiking trail in northern France, Belgium, and the Netherlands, in an east–west direction ending in Germany. It is part of the GR footpath network of European long-distance trails.
